FLEETCOR is one of Forbes’ Global Growth Champions and one of Forbes’ World's Most Innovative Companies. We also rank among Fortune’s 1000 companies, Fortune's 100 Fastest Growing Companies and much more. We are leading the future of business payments. Our specialized payment solutions help businesses control, simplify, and secure payment for fuel, general payables, toll and lodging expenses. 800K business customers and millions of people in over 80 countries around the world use our solutions for their payments. We provide our customers various fuel payment products, including cards (such as CCS in Czech Rep. or Travelcard in the Netherlands).
